Give one example each of a salt which gives an aqueous solution having

(a) pH less than 7


(b) pH equal to 7


(c) pH more than 7

(a) pH less than 7-Ammonium chloride

(b) pH equal to 7-sodium chloride


(c) pH more than 7- sodium carbonate.
